Skip to content

Commit

Permalink
merged the ridesharing code
Browse files Browse the repository at this point in the history
  • Loading branch information
null committed Aug 17, 2012
1 parent 514b8ac commit 8cba617
Show file tree
Hide file tree
Showing 204 changed files with 3,158 additions and 28,199 deletions.
40 changes: 13 additions & 27 deletions occupywallst/admin.py
Expand Up @@ -17,36 +17,9 @@
from django.contrib.admin import AdminSite as BaseAdminSite
from django.contrib.gis.admin import OSMGeoAdmin
from django.contrib.auth.admin import UserAdmin as BaseUserAdmin, GroupAdmin

import taggit.admin

from occupywallst import models as db


class AdminSite(BaseAdminSite):
def __init__(self, *args, **kwargs):
BaseAdminSite.__init__(self, *args, **kwargs)
self.register(db.User, UserAdmin)
self.register(db.Group, GroupAdmin)
self.register(db.Carousel, CarouselAdmin)
self.register(db.Verbiage, VerbiageAdmin)
self.register(db.NewsArticle, ArticleAdmin)
self.register(db.ForumPost, ArticleAdmin)
self.register(db.UserInfo, UserInfoAdmin)
self.register(db.Comment, CommentAdmin)
self.register(db.RideRequest, GeoAdmin)
self.register(db.Ride, GeoAdmin)
self.register(db.SpamText, admin.ModelAdmin)
self.register(db.List, ListAdmin)
self.register(db.ListMember, ListMemberAdmin)
self.register(db.Pledge, PledgeAdmin)
self.register(taggit.admin.Tag, taggit.admin.TagAdmin)
self.register(taggit.admin.TaggedItem)
# message table intentionally excluded. i don't want to tempt
# myself or anyone else using the backend to read private
# conversations.


class GeoAdmin(OSMGeoAdmin):
default_lat = 39.95 # philadelphia
default_lon = -75.16
Expand Down Expand Up @@ -275,3 +248,16 @@ class PledgeAdmin(admin.ModelAdmin):
list_display = ['name', 'email', 'zipcode', 'ip', 'created'] + list_filter
search_fields = ['name', 'email', 'zipcode', 'ip']
ordering = ['-created']


admin.site.register(db.Carousel, CarouselAdmin)
admin.site.register(db.Verbiage, VerbiageAdmin)
admin.site.register(db.NewsArticle, ArticleAdmin)
admin.site.register(db.ForumPost, ArticleAdmin)
admin.site.register(db.UserInfo, UserInfoAdmin)
admin.site.register(db.Comment, CommentAdmin)
admin.site.register(db.SpamText, admin.ModelAdmin)
admin.site.register(db.List, ListAdmin)
admin.site.register(db.ListMember, ListMemberAdmin)
admin.site.register(db.Pledge, PledgeAdmin)

18 changes: 0 additions & 18 deletions occupywallst/forms.py
Expand Up @@ -111,24 +111,6 @@ def save(self):
self.user = user
return super(SignupForm, self).save()


class RideForm(forms.ModelForm):
class Meta:
model = db.Ride
exclude = ['seats_used', 'route', 'route_data', 'forum_post']


class RideRequestForm(forms.Form):
info = forms.CharField(help_text="Want a seat? Tell us about yourself.",
widget=forms.widgets.Textarea)
def save(self, user, ride):
ride_request = db.RideRequest(user=user,ride=ride)
ride_request.status = "pending"
ride_request.info = self.cleaned_data['info']
ride_request.save()
return ride_request


class SubscribeForm(forms.Form):
email = forms.EmailField()

Expand Down
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.

Large diffs are not rendered by default.

Binary file not shown.
Binary file not shown.
Binary file not shown.
Binary file not shown.
Binary file not shown.
Binary file not shown.
Binary file not shown.
Binary file not shown.
Binary file not shown.
Binary file not shown.
Binary file not shown.
Binary file not shown.
30 changes: 0 additions & 30 deletions occupywallst/media/jquery-ui/development-bundle/AUTHORS.txt

This file was deleted.

278 changes: 0 additions & 278 deletions occupywallst/media/jquery-ui/development-bundle/GPL-LICENSE.txt

This file was deleted.

0 comments on commit 8cba617

Please sign in to comment.